Heim  >  Artikel  >  Backend-Entwicklung  >  Wie man mit Pandas liest

Wie man mit Pandas liest

DDD
DDDOriginal
2023-12-05 15:33:422311Durchsuche

Das Betriebssystem dieses Tutorials: Windows 10-System, Dell G3-Computer.

Pandas ist eine beliebte Python-Datenverarbeitungsbibliothek, mit der verschiedene Datenformate gelesen und verarbeitet werden können. Im Folgenden sind die allgemeinen Schritte zum Lesen von Dateien mit Pandas aufgeführt:

1. Importieren Sie die Pandas-Bibliothek:

import pandas as pd

2. Verwenden Sie die Funktion pd.read_csv(), um die CSV-Datei zu lesen:

data = pd.read_csv('file.csv')

file.csv ist der Pfad zur zu lesenden CSV-Datei.

3. Wenn Sie eine Excel-Datei lesen möchten, können Sie die Funktion pd.read_excel() verwenden:

data = pd.read_excel('file.xlsx')

wobei file.xlsx der Pfad zur zu lesenden Excel-Datei ist.

4. Wenn Sie Daten in einer SQL-Datenbank lesen möchten, können Sie die Funktion pd.read_sql() verwenden:

import sqlite3
conn = sqlite3.connect('database.db')
data = pd.read_sql('SELECT * FROM table_name', conn)

wobei Datenbank.db der Datenbankdateipfad und Tabellenname der Name der zu erstellenden Tabelle ist lesen.

5. Wenn Sie eine JSON-Datei lesen möchten, können Sie die Funktion pd.read_json() verwenden:

data = pd.read_json('file.json')

wobei file.json der Pfad der zu lesenden JSON-Datei ist.

6. Wenn Sie eine Textdatei lesen möchten, können Sie die Funktion pd.read_table() verwenden:

data = pd.read_table('file.txt', delimiter=',')

Dabei ist file.txt der Pfad der zu lesenden Textdatei und das Trennzeichen die Als Trennzeichen wird hier die Komma-Trennung verwendet.

Die oben genannten Schritte sind die allgemeinen Schritte zum Lesen verschiedener Dateitypen mit Pandas. Wählen Sie entsprechend der tatsächlichen Situation die entsprechende Funktion aus und stellen Sie die entsprechenden Parameter nach Bedarf ein.

Das obige ist der detaillierte Inhalt vonWie man mit Pandas liest.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Stellungnahme:
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n